Guerlain is the oldest perfume and beauty maison in continuous operation, founded in 1828 by Pierre-François-Pascal Guerlain at 42 rue de Rivoli in Paris. The Guerlain family ran the business for five generations, creating signature fragrances like Eau de Cologne Impériale for Empress Eugénie in 1853, Shalimar in 1925, and L'Heure Bleue — perfumes that effectively defined what 'French luxury fragrance' would mean for the next century. In 1994 the house was acquired by LVMH, which has invested heavily in expanding the makeup and skincare divisions while preserving the heritage of Avenue des Champs-Élysées as the historic Maison Guerlain.

Today Guerlain sits in the LVMH Beauty division alongside Parfums Christian Dior, and is led by CEO Gabrielle Saint-Genis Rodriguez (since October 2023). The flagship makeup ranges — Rouge G, Météorites pearls, Terracotta bronzer, and KissKiss Bee Glow — share shelf space with Abeille Royale (the bee-honey-based skincare line that drives a significant share of the maison's revenue) and the heritage fragrance vault. Guerlain's positioning is the most overtly historic in luxury beauty: thirteen-letter Guerlinade, beekeeper conservation work on Ouessant island, and a price point that signals the difference between 'prestige' and 'maison'.
